You simple don´t need a CCS as allied HQ unless you plan to go with lots of heavy weapon teams and support them with orders. The master of ordance is very unaccurate and will die toghter with his squad very soon, because he has no vehicle to hide in.

The PCS is not able to form a shield - ists only 5 man and they will be gunned down, if they block the path. The have to act defensiv.

The Troops are importat because they shall be able to hold a objective - head down, if it must. Will your tougher IW will fight to capture objective in enemy hands.

Now to heavy support: If you want to go with efficency, take a manticore. 1-3 5" plates can do a lot of harm to vehicles and light infantery as well. The min. distance is much shorter than that of the basi. If you like it stylewise and have to kill lots of 3+ get a basi (or to or three). If you want a direct shooting hard hitter, that is able to kill almost anything - here is the medusa sige gun. A demolisher cannon with 36".

If you like to have a HS that will last longer, get a leman, but hey you´re playing IW so you need artillery:cool:
